Album Notes

Andy, Dennis and Jeff, known as ADJ live in the Black Hills of South Dakota. Semiprofessional musicians, they began recording in 1998 at the urging of a close following of fans. They built Spirit Valley Studio in 1998 and recorded their first track to Extempore in March of that year. All thirteen tracks of this album are presented in chronological order, with minimal post processing and no mixing. Everything on Extempore was recorded live directly to a 2-track digital disk. What you hear is the evolution of ADJ from 03/20/98 to 03/29/02.

ADJ is Andy Roltgen on MIDI guitar, Dennis Williams on drums and Jeff Roltgen on the Chapman Stick. All three men are lifetime students of philosophy, physics, music and technology.
